Sed είναι ένας επεξεργαστής ρεύμα για το λειτουργικό σύστημα Unix και Linux . Παίρνει μια γραμμή κειμένου από ένα ρεύμα εισόδου , βρίσκει ένα συγκεκριμένο μοτίβο και το αντικαθιστά με ένα άλλο πρότυπο . Η εντολή αποτελείται από τέσσερα μέρη : η εντολή υποκατάστατο ( "s" ) , οριοθέτησης , πρότυπο αναζήτησης και αντικατάσταση συμβολοσειράς . Η συμβολοσειρά εισόδου μπορεί να είναι η γραμμή εντολών ή ένα αρχείο . Οι αλλαγές μπορούν να εκτυπωθούν στην οθόνη ή σε άλλο αρχείο . Οδηγίες
Η
1 Ανοίξτε ένα παράθυρο τερματικού ή συνδεθείτε σε μια συνεδρία SSH . 2
Πληκτρολογήστε την εντολή " sed ' s /old /new » ? new.txt " για να αντικαταστήσει την πρώτη εμφάνιση του string" παλιά "με το string" νέα "στο αρχείο που ονομάζεται" original.txt " . . Οι αλλαγές θα πρέπει να εξεταστεί υπό το αρχείο που ονομάζεται " new.txt . " Κατάργηση " > new.txt " για την έξοδο των αλλαγών στην οθόνη .
Εικόνων 3 Πληκτρολογήστε την εντολή " sed ' s /old /new /g ' new.txt "για να αντικαταστησει όλες τις εμφανίσεις του string" παλιά "με το string" νέα "στο αρχείο που ονομάζεται" original.txt . "
Η 4 Πληκτρολογήστε την εντολή " sed - e ' s /old /new /g ' -e ' s /a //A g ' new.txt "για να αντικαταστήσει όλες τις περιπτώσεις του string" παλιό " με το string " νέα " και όλων των περιπτώσεις " ένα " με τις εμφανίσεις του " Α" στο αρχείο " original.txt . "
Η
εικόνων